Abstract

168,926. Eccles, W., and Metropolitan- Vickers Electrical Co., Ltd. March 18, 1920. Machinery frames.-In means for connecting one body to or supporting it without twisting from four points on a second body liable to twisting out of the plane most nearly containing the four points, applicable for carrying engines, gear casings, and bodies on motor-car chassis, engines on aeroplanes, gear-casings in ships, &c., one body is flexibly secured at four calculated points to the four members of a quadilateral frame, the four angular points of which are flexibly connected to the second body. Fig. 4 shows an engine x flexibly secured at calculated points 35, 36, 37, 38 to a quadrilateral frame 31, 32, 33, 34, which is similarly secured at its angular points to the chassis parts 18, 24, 22, 23. The car body is similarly secured to the frame 39, 40, 41, 42. Flexible joints may be provided by the use of bolt connections allowing freedom or lost motion. As applied to ships, a gear-casing is carried on beams 7, 8, 9, 10, Fig. 3, of which 7, 9, 10 are connected to the webs of beams 2, 3, 4, 5 constituting the quadilateral frame and riveted to the supporting tank-plates 1, which are capable of flexure under the stresses concerned. The beams 2, 3, 4, 5 are rigid on the planes of their webs but are capable of lateral flexure and of twisting about their longitudinal axes.
